如何搭建高级匿名的http(s)代理

首页 / 常见问题 / 低代码开发 / 如何搭建高级匿名的http(s)代理
作者:低代码系统搭建 发布时间:11-26 18:10 浏览量:3733
logo
织信企业级低代码开发平台
提供表单、流程、仪表盘、API等功能,非IT用户可通过设计表单来收集数据,设计流程来进行业务协作,使用仪表盘来进行数据分析与展示,IT用户可通过API集成第三方系统平台数据。
免费试用

高级匿名的HTTP(S)代理是一种重要的在线隐私工具,可帮助用户隐藏它们的IP地址、加密通讯内容、绕过网络审查和地理限制。要搭建高级匿名的HTTP(S)代理,您需要选择合适的代理软件、配置服务器、设置强大的加密、确保认证机制到位、优化代理性能,并持续监控与更新以保持最高水平的匿名性。在这些核心观点中,特别值得注意的是选择合适的代理软件是基础。它不仅涉及软件的能力,尤其是加密和安全性能,还要考虑到软件是否得到积极维护,以及是否有强大的社区支持来应对潜在的安全漏洞。

一、选择合适的代理软件

选择合适的代理软件是搭建匿名代理的起点。代理软件决定了你能为用户提供哪些功能,以及能实现怎样的安全水平。

Squid 是最流行的HTTP/HTTPS代理之一,它提供了丰富的功能和配置选项,能够实现高级的缓存功能,以优化速度并减轻服务器负担。HAProxyNginx 同样可以被配置作为代理,他们在高可用性和性能方面有着良好的口碑。

在搭建过程中,要确保代理软件配置能处理好客户端的请求信息,不泄露真实IP地址。这包括对于HTTP的 X-Forwarded-For 头部的处理,确保代理服务器不向目标网站透露原始用户的信息。

二、配置服务器

在选择了合适的代理软件后,接下来需要设置服务器。这不仅仅是软件层面的配置,还包括了硬件和网络环境的选择。选择位于隐私友好国家的服务器商是一个好选择,因为这能够额外提供法律层面的保护。

配置服务器时,必须确保所有的软件都是最新的,所有不必要的服务都已关闭,以减少被攻击的表面。SSL/TLS证书应当得到妥善配置,确保所有传输的数据都经过加密。

三、设置强大的加密

搭建匿名代理的核心在于保证数据传输过程的安全性和隐私性,因此设置强大的加密非常关键。使用TLS协议,可以为代理服务器与客户端之间的通信提供端到端的加密。

配置TLS时,应选择强加密套件,并定期更新您的加密配置,以保护对抗不断进化的威胁。

四、确保认证机制到位

为了防止代理服务器被恶意用户滥用,一个健全的认证系统是必要的。可以使用基本的HTTP认证,或者更安全的方法如OAuth。

代理认证 不仅帮助保护代理服务器,还能提供使用者身份的验证,增加一层安全保障。

五、优化代理性能

用户期待代理服务能够提供快速响应的体验。这意味着代理服务器的性能优化尤为重要。从负载均衡、缓存策略到连接池管理,都是潜在的优化点。

缓存机制可以显著提高代理服务器的效率,通过保存常访问的资源来减少冗余请求,从而提升速度。

六、持续监控与更新

即使您的代理服务器在初始设置后运行良好,也必须持续监控其运行状况,并定期进行更新。监控可以帮助您及时发现问题,并在问题成为真正威胁之前予以解决。

而软件和系统的更新则可以保护您的系统不受已知安全漏洞的威胁。确保代理软件、操作系统、TLS证书等都保持最新。

七、总结

搭建高级匿名的HTTP(S)代理不仅仅是技术上的挑战,也涉及到对隐私、安全以及用户体验的持续维护和改进。通过精心规划和执行上述步骤,可以为用户提供一个既安全又快速的匿名代理服务。记住,这个过程需要持续的努力与更新,以适应快速变化的网络环境和保持最高级别的匿名性。

相关问答FAQs:

什么是高级匿名的http(s)代理?

高级匿名的http(s)代理是一种网络工具,用于隐藏用户的真实IP地址和身份,并通过代理服务器与目标网站建立连接,从而实现更高级别的匿名性和隐私保护。

如何搭建高级匿名的http(s)代理?

  1. 首先,选择合适的代理软件:可以选择常用的代理软件如Shadowsocks、V2Ray、Tor等,它们都具有高级匿名的特性和配置选项,可以满足不同的需求。

  2. 其次,获取代理服务器:可以购买高匿名代理服务器服务,确保服务器的稳定性和速度。或者自行搭建代理服务器,将其放置在安全可靠的网络环境中。

  3. 然后,配置代理软件:根据所选代理软件的使用说明,进行相应的配置。通常需要设置代理服务器的地址、端口、加密方式等信息。

  4. 接下来,测试代理连接:运行代理软件,确保能够成功连接到代理服务器。可以使用网络工具或浏览器插件进行测试,确认是否能够通过代理访问网站。

  5. 最后,优化代理设置:根据实际需求,进一步优化代理软件的设置。例如,可以设置代理服务器的定时更换、自动切换IP地址等功能,提高匿名性和安全性。

为什么选择高级匿名的http(s)代理?

高级匿名的http(s)代理可以带来多重好处:

  1. 隐藏真实IP地址和身份:使用高级匿名的代理,可以有效隐藏用户的真实IP地址和身份信息,保护个人隐私。

  2. 解决地区限制:通过连接到代理服务器,可以绕过地区限制,访问被封锁的网站和资源,获得更广泛的网络访问权限。

  3. 提高安全性:代理服务器充当中间人,与目标网站建立连接,并进行数据的传输。这样可以在一定程度上保护用户的网络安全,避免直接暴露在互联网上。

  4. 加速网络访问:有些代理服务器可以提供加速功能,通过缓存和压缩等技术,加快网页加载速度,提升用户体验。

综上所述,搭建高级匿名的http(s)代理可以为用户提供更高级别的匿名性、隐私保护和网络访问自由。

最后建议,企业在引入信息化系统初期,切记要合理有效地运用好工具,这样一来不仅可以让公司业务高效地运行,还能最大程度保证团队目标的达成。同时还能大幅缩短系统开发和部署的时间成本。特别是有特定需求功能需要定制化的企业,可以采用我们公司自研的企业级低代码平台织信Informat。 织信平台基于数据模型优先的设计理念,提供大量标准化的组件,内置AI助手、组件设计器、自动化(图形化编程)、脚本、工作流引擎(BPMN2.0)、自定义API、表单设计器、权限、仪表盘等功能,能帮助企业构建高度复杂核心的数字化系统。如ERP、MES、CRM、PLM、SCM、WMS、项目管理、流程管理等多个应用场景,全面助力企业落地国产化/信息化/数字化转型战略目标。 版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系我们微信:Informat_5 处理,核实后本网站将在24小时内删除。

版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系邮箱:hopper@cornerstone365.cn 处理,核实后本网站将在24小时内删除。

最近更新

低代码怎么做:《低代码开发:入门与实践》
12-20 17:13
低代码开发安卓:《安卓开发:低代码新趋势》
12-20 17:13
人工智能低代码开发:《AI赋能:低代码开发新动力》
12-20 17:13
低代码·开发平台:《低代码开发平台:新趋势》
12-20 17:13
安卓低代码开发:《安卓低代码开发平台推荐》
12-20 17:13
低代码厂商排名:《2024低代码厂商排名》
12-20 17:13
低代码框架推荐:《2024低代码框架推荐》
12-20 17:13
低代码工业开发:《工业应用:低代码开发新趋势》
12-20 17:13
低代码平台开发应用系统:《低代码平台:应用系统开发》
12-20 17:13

立即开启你的数字化管理

用心为每一位用户提供专业的数字化解决方案及业务咨询

  • 深圳市基石协作科技有限公司
  • 地址:深圳市南山区科技中一路大族激光科技中心909室
  • 座机:400-185-5850
  • 手机:137-1379-6908
  • 邮箱:sales@cornerstone365.cn
  • 微信公众号二维码

© copyright 2019-2024. 织信INFORMAT 深圳市基石协作科技有限公司 版权所有 | 粤ICP备15078182号

前往Gitee仓库
微信公众号二维码
咨询织信数字化顾问获取最新资料
数字化咨询热线
400-185-5850
申请预约演示
立即与行业专家交流